THE Easiest Pizza Crust

ingredients
- 1 tablespoon yeast
- 1 1⁄4 cups all-purpose flour
- 1⁄2 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on italian seasoning
- 2⁄3 cup water (110 degrees F)
- 1⁄2 teaspoon sugar
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
directions
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F.
- In medium bowl using regular beaters (not dough hooks), blend all ingredients on low speed.
- Beat on high speed for 3 minutes.
- (If mixer bounces around bowl, dough is too stiff. Add water if necessary, one tablespoon at a time, until dough does not resist beaters. If dough is too wet, add more flour.) Dough will resemble soft bread dough.
- Put mixture on a floured 12-inch pizza pan or cookie sheet.
- Sprinkle flour on dough, then press dough onto pan, continuing to sprinkle with flour to prevent sticking to hands.
- Make edges slightly thicker to hold toppings.
- Bake pizza crust for 10 minutes.
- Remove from oven, then reduce heat to 400 degrees F.
- Spread pizza crust with your favorite sauce and toppings, and lightly scrape the bottom if it's stuck to the pan in places.
- Bake another 10 to 15 minutes or until top is nicely browned.
